Boosting Energy Partnerships And Economic Cooperation

Closing sub-Saharan Africa’s massive energy access gap will require substantial investments; around 20 billion USD through 2030, according to the IEA. Asian and European nations are at the forefront of hydrogen technology development, focusing on creating hydrogen solutions through renewable and low carbon energy sources including solar, wind and gas, as well as investing heavily in infrastructure, such as hydrogen fuelling stations and production plants, to create a sustainable hydrogen supply chain. What opportunities exist for furthering Asia and EU’s cooperation with Africa? How can energy security be harmonised across continents?
